In the race of Moto2 of the Argentine Grand Prix, we saw some particularly virile passes of arms taking place between the leading men. The contacts took place, and as said Gardner on arrival, there was finally no reason to complain since everyone was able to at least give what they received. But officials have a different opinion. A sanction has just fallen against KTM official Brad Binder. The first and the last?

The facts concern the last battle for the finish between the South African and Marcel Schrötter. For the gain of fifth place, virilely taken by the teammate of Jorge Martin who fell after a collision with Joe Roberts. But the former Moto3 World Champion will have to return this top 5 to his German rival.

The stewards sanctioned him for irresponsible driving, which falls under article 1.21.2 of the FIM World Championship Grand Prix Regulations which states that “ drivers must drive responsibly, so as not to endanger other competitors or participants, on the track or in the pit lane ».

Brad Binder therefore ends his escapade at Termas sixth and not fifth. Schrötter goes the opposite way.
